examples - jquery mobile themes
corrige la orientaciĆ³n de la pĆ”gina al paisaje solo en Jquery-mobile (3)
¿Cómo puede la orientación de una página ser horizontal solo cuando estoy usando jquery mobile para mi aplicación web?
La página contiene algunos datos tabulares que no se pueden mostrar en el modo vertical en la versión móvil ...
Eche un vistazo a mi diseño .. http://jsfiddle.net/nY5ZF/1/
¿Se puede arreglar esto?
No puede bloquear la rotación del navegador, pero lo que puede hacer es usar una hoja de estilo diferente para una orientación y otra hoja de estilo que ocultará todo en modo vertical.
<link rel="stylesheet" type="text/css" href="css/style_l.css" media="screen and (orientation: landscape)">
<link rel="stylesheet" type="text/css" href="css/style_p.css" media="screen and (orientation: portrait)">
Ahora tenemos tablas responsivas en jquerymobile 1.3.1, podrías usar eso ...
http://jquerymobile.com/demos/1.3.0-beta.1/docs/tables/
Como no es posible bloquear la orientación en webapps a diferencia de las aplicaciones híbridas (phonegap). Algunos navegadores simplemente no nos ayudan en eso.
A continuación, puede visualizar estos datos en formato de lista O simplemente verificar el modo, si es un retrato, luego dé un mensaje simple "Para ver la tabla, use el paisaje".
Intente utilizar la propiedad de orientation
de jQuery Mobile y establézcalo en falso.
jQuery.mobile.orientationChangeEnabled = false;
Esto debería necesariamente hacer un retroceso en el evento de cambio de tamaño de la ventana. El tamaño puede ser manejado por CSS3 de min-width